What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Lexington to Vietnam?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Lexington to Vietnam cl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

Your flight ticket price will generally be cheaper if you fly to Vietnam on a Saturday and more expensive on a Wednesday. On your return trip to Lexington, you should consider flying back on a Sunday, and avoid Wednesdays for better deals.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Lexington to Vietnam?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Lexington to Vietnam with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Vietnam?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Vietnam is generally in the morning, when round-trip flights cost $1,433 on average. Morning departures are around 23%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Vietnam is generally in the evening,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$1,864.
